Leafpad features and specs

  • Simple User Interface
    Leafpad provides a minimalistic interface that is easy to navigate, making it accessible for all users who need a straightforward text editor without the distraction of complex features.
  • Lightweight
    The application is very lightweight, which means it consumes very little system resources, making it an ideal choice for older hardware or systems with limited memory.
  • Fast Performance
    Due to its simplicity and lack of bloatware, Leafpad offers quick startup times and responsive performance, even on less powerful computers.
  • Cross-platform
    Leafpad is available on various Unix-based systems, including Linux, making it versatile for different operating environments.
  • Open Source
    As an open-source application, Leafpad's code can be reviewed and modified by anyone, which promotes transparency and community-driven development.

Possible disadvantages of Leafpad

  • Limited Features
    Leafpad lacks many of the advanced features found in other modern text editors, such as syntax highlighting, tabbed editing, or integrated search and replace functionality.
  • No Plugin Support
    The application does not support plugins or extensions, which means users cannot add additional functionality beyond what is originally included.
  • Minimal Customization
    Users have limited options for customizing the interface or settings, which might not satisfy those who prefer a personalized editing environment.
  • No Longer Actively Developed
    Leafpad has not seen significant updates for a while, potentially leading to compatibility issues or lacking up-to-date features found in newer text editors.
  • Basic Editing Capabilities
    While suitable for simple text editing tasks, Leafpad is not designed for more complex document editing, scripting, or programming needs.

React Complex Tree features and specs

  • Customizability
    React Complex Tree offers a high degree of customizability, allowing developers to tailor the tree component to fit their specific needs. This can be especially useful for creating unique UI experiences.
  • Feature-Rich
    The library includes a wide range of features out of the box such as drag-and-drop support, keyboard navigation, and dynamic data loading, which can save development time.
  • Accessibility Support
    React Complex Tree is designed with accessibility in mind, providing support for ARIA attributes and keyboard interactions, which helps ensure that applications are usable by people with disabilities.
  • Performance
    The component is optimized for performance, handling large data sets efficiently without significant slowdowns, which is critical for applications that manage extensive hierarchical structures.
  • Community and Documentation
    The library has a supportive community and well-structured documentation, providing developers with ample resources to troubleshoot and extend its functionality.

Possible disadvantages of React Complex Tree

  • Complexity
    Due to its extensive features and customizability, React Complex Tree can be complex to set up and configure properly, which may lead to a steeper learning curve for new users.
  • Bundle Size
    As a feature-rich component, React Complex Tree can increase your bundle size, which might be a concern for projects where performance and loading time are critical.
  • Third-Party Dependency
    Relying on a third-party library introduces dependencies outside of your control, which may present challenges in terms of long-term maintenance and potential update or deprecation issues.
  • Specific Use Case Tailoring
    While it offers a lot of features, developers may find that very specific use cases require additional effort to customize or extend the component beyond its intended use.

Analysis of React Complex Tree

Overall verdict

  • React Complex Tree is a solid, headless React library for building tree-view UI components, offering strong accessibility support, drag-and-drop, multi-selection, and search out of the box, while giving developers full control over styling and rendering. It's a good choice for developers who need a robust, unstyled tree component without reinventing complex interaction logic.

Why this product is good

  • Headless design gives full control over styling and markup, making it easy to integrate with any design system or CSS framework
  • Built-in accessibility (ARIA-compliant, keyboard navigation) saves significant development time
  • Supports advanced features like drag-and-drop reordering, multi-selection, and renaming out of the box
  • Actively maintained with good documentation and TypeScript support
  • Flexible data model that supports both controlled and uncontrolled tree state management
  • Free and open-source with no licensing costs

Recommended for

  • Developers building file explorers, folder structures, or nested navigation menus
  • Teams that need a customizable tree component that matches their existing design system
  • Projects requiring accessible, keyboard-navigable tree interfaces
  • Applications needing drag-and-drop reordering of hierarchical data
  • TypeScript-based React projects seeking type-safe tree components
  • Developers who prefer headless UI libraries over pre-styled component kits
